@Travis Yes other issues with memlock. I spent more time that I would have like to yesterday trying to get the memlock issue isolated. It is not the kernel, so for purposes of this bug, it is not an issue.
The real memlock problem was with pulse audio. I didn't realize that qjackctl was a shell script that also called pasuspender. That is what was causing most of my problems. I found if I stopped pulse (pacmd suspend 1), I could start jackd from the command line. From qjackctl I would get Bus Error. Then I found I could start qjackctl and jackd if I started qjackctl.bin instead. Still not out of the woods, other audio apps launched from the gnome toolbar or menu would still fail. For now I have removed pulse audio and as a result ubuntu.desktop which depends on it.
